CHC Group Introduces Advanced AW139 Helicopters to Enhance Emergency Response in Western Australia

CHC Helicopter has announced the introduction of three upgraded AW139 helicopters, known as RAC Rescue, into service in Western Australia. These helicopters, specially modified for all-hazards rescue and advanced aeromedical care, are part of a AUS $26.7 million investment by the WA Government to enhance the state's emergency response capabilities. The aircraft boast faster speeds, longer range, and advanced onboard care, enabling them to deliver critical care within the vital 'golden hour'. The RAC Rescue helicopters, operated by CHC and funded by the State Government, are managed by the Department of Fire and Emergency Services and sponsored by RAC. This operational transition replaces the Bell 412EP's that have flown over 10,500 missions since 2003.
